CVE-2016-6273 is a denial-of-service vulnerability affecting the lmadmin component of Flexera FlexNet Publisher, specifically versions before 2015 SP5 and 2016 R1 SP1, as well as Citrix License Server for Windows and VPX before version 11.14.0.1. An unauthenticated remote attacker can crash the affected service by sending a specially crafted type 2F packet with a '01 19' opcode. This vulnerability has a CVSS v3 score of 7.5 (High), indicating a network-based attack with low complexity and a high impact on availability. There is no evidence of active exploitation, public exploit code (Metasploit, Nuclei, ExploitDB), or significant community discussion or media coverage surrounding this CVE.
